## Runbook — GarageSense occupancy feed release

Welcome aboard. Before deploying the GarageSense occupancy feed, confirm the stall-counter backfill has completed and the Larkmont garage sensors report green. Tag the release, run the schema validator, and only then publish to the feed gateway. All published manifests must be verified by downstream consumers, so sign the release with the key below.

signing key of fajop-tahop = bky9_qdL6xeDv7

### Account Recovery — Catalogue Import (Lintwood)

Quick one for review: when the Lintwood catalogue import wipes a patron's session table, the recovery flow re-seeds accounts from the nightly snapshot. Check that the importer skips locked accounts — last time it didn't. To rerun recovery against staging you'll need the vault passphrase, which is appended just below.

recovery phrase for yafof-tajof: julmir-kelax-julvan-holath-belvan-holir-ralael-ralvan-ralath-julvan-silmir-istmir-kaswyn-ulamir

The Bramleigh CI suite keeps failing the post-deploy stage because the Vexlar load balancer marks pods unhealthy during JVM warmup. The health endpoint answers 503 for roughly 40 seconds, and our check allows only three failures. I've raised the unhealthy threshold to eight in this PR; no app changes. To verify against staging, use the build token shown below.

trace token, fafog-kageg: htk4_98e6

## Break-Glass: Donation-Receipt Mailer

Welcome aboard! If the Lanternfall receipt mailer jams during a giving campaign and nobody senior is around, you're allowed to use break-glass access to the mailer console. Ping the on-call channel first, note the time, and file a short incident note afterward — no exceptions. Access expires after 30 minutes. To unlock the emergency console, enter the passphrase below.

recovery phrase for fawif-tajeg: norael-aldmir-casir-brivan-ulaion